Sea Stachura Augusta riot oral histories

 Collection
Identifier: MSS-378
Abstract

Histories were recorded as part of a larger project which remains unfinished. The work did give rise to a series of public discussions "Help Recover History: Let's Talk About the 1970 Riot. Sea Stachura was moderator and the panel consisted of riot witnesses and a university professor
